1. Conquer Plaque with an Electric Toothbrush
Using a manual toothbrush can sometimes leave plaque behind, especially in hard-to-reach areas of your mouth.
Electric toothbrushes are designed to effectively remove plaque from teeth and gums, offering a more thorough clean.
Many electric toothbrushes come equipped with rotating and oscillating bristles that can reach difficult spots that manual brushing often misses.
The bristles vibrate at high speeds, which helps to break down plaque more efficiently and prevent cavities and tooth decay.
Some models also feature pressure sensors to ensure you’re not brushing too hard, which can protect your enamel and gums from damage.
This targeted approach to plaque removal makes electric toothbrushes a powerful tool in maintaining oral health and reducing the risk of dental problems.
For those looking to enhance their dental care routine, switching to an electric toothbrush can lead to healthier teeth and gums.

6. Keep Your Brush Head Fresh for Better Cleaning
To achieve the best results with an electric toothbrush, the brush head requires regular care and replacement.
Dentists recommend changing the brush head about every three months or sooner if the bristles look bent or worn.
After each use, rinse the brush head with clean water and let it air dry in an upright position.
Avoid covering the brush head while it is still wet, as this can trap moisture and lead to bacterial growth.
Keeping your brush head clean and replacing it on time helps your electric toothbrush clean your teeth more effectively and keeps your mouth healthier.

9. Dentist-Approved Oral Care
Many dentists and every dental hygienist agree that electric toothbrushes can help people clean their teeth more effectively.
Research has shown that they remove more plaque and reduce gum inflammation better than manual toothbrushes.
Features like built-in timers and pressure sensors remind users to brush for the right amount of time and with the correct pressure.
A dental hygienist often recommends electric toothbrushes to patients who struggle with hard-to-reach areas or uneven brushing habits.
Using one can also make professional cleanings easier because there is usually less plaque and tartar buildup.
Following these dentist-and hygienist-approved practices helps maintain stronger teeth and healthier gums over time.

11. Find Your Perfect Electric Toothbrush
Finding the right electric toothbrush can make a big difference in your oral health.
Brands like Oral-B offer many models with features that fit different needs and budgets.
Some brushes move thousands of times per minute, which helps remove more plaque and keeps your teeth clean with less effort.
If you have sensitive gums, look for a model with soft bristles and a gentle cleaning mode.
Those who want whiter teeth may prefer a brush with a polishing or whitening setting.
Many advanced models include timers, pressure sensors, and even Bluetooth connections to track your brushing habits.
Choosing a toothbrush that matches your preferences can make daily brushing easier and more effective.
By taking the time to compare features and prices, you can find the electric toothbrush that helps you keep your mouth healthy and your smile bright.

β FAQs
1. How often should I replace the brush head on my electric toothbrush?
It is best to replace the brush head every three months or sooner if the bristles look bent or worn.
Worn bristles clean less effectively and can be rough on your gums.
Fresh brush heads help remove more plaque and keep your mouth cleaner.
2. Can electric toothbrushes be used by children?
Yes, many electric toothbrushes are made specifically for children.
These models are smaller, softer, and often include fun designs or timers to help kids brush correctly.
An adult needs to supervise brushing to make sure the child uses the brush safely and gently.
3. Are electric toothbrushes safe for people with braces or dental work?
Electric toothbrushes are safe for people with braces, implants, or crowns.
The small, moving bristles can clean around brackets and wires more easily than manual brushes.
Using the right brush head and gentle pressure helps keep both the dental work and gums healthy.
4. How long should I brush with an electric toothbrush?
Most dentists recommend brushing for two minutes, twice a day.
Many electric toothbrushes have built-in timers that let you know when to move to a different area of your mouth.
Brushing for the full two minutes ensures that all surfaces of your teeth are cleaned well.
5. Are electric toothbrushes worth the cost?
Although they cost more than manual toothbrushes, electric toothbrushes often provide better cleaning and can help prevent costly dental problems.
Their features, such as timers and pressure sensors, also make brushing easier and more consistent.
Over time, the health benefits can make them a smart investment for your oral care routine.
